Seasonal fruits take over at produce market
WITH the fall coming, seasonal fruits are available at Shanghai Mei Hui Yuan Fruit Market at Duhui Road in Minhang District.
Apples, hami melon, pear, jujube and other fruits are available in early autumn, replacing summer fruits like water melon, grape, pear and plum.
There are more than 30 stalls in the market, and fruit vendors will warmly recommend the best options after asking customers whether they intend to eat it themselves or send as gifts.
They will cut a slice of fruit you are interested in for a free taste and are happy to help customers carry fruits to see them off at the gate of the market. Imported fruits are a third cheaper than in supermarkets.
Address: 2385 Duhui Rd, near Zhuanxing Rd E.
Hours: 7am-5pm
